Analysis
The most recent figure for mules and hinnies — manure applied to soils that volatilises in Pakistan is 45,837 kg, measured in 2023.
The figure is up 1.9% on the previous year and up 19.3% over ten years.
Over the whole period, mules and hinnies — manure applied to soils that volatilises in Pakistan peaked at 54,786 kg in 2005 and was at its lowest, 5,619 kg, in 1962.
Pakistan ranks 7th of 81 countries on this measure, in the top 10%.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
